/* margin-top属性 */ p { margin-top: -20px; } /* top属性 */ div { position: relative; top: -10px; }
上面的代码展示了两种不同的方法来实现向上偏移。首先,大家使用了margin-top
属性,将p元素的顶部向上移动了20像素。注意,在这种情况下,大家使用了负值,因为大家想要将元素从它原来的位置移开。
大家还可以使用top
属性来实现向上偏移。首先,大家需要将元素的position
属性设置为relative
,这是因为如果未设置,则top
属性无效。然后,大家可以使用负值将元素的顶部向上移动,例如在上面的代码中,大家将div元素的顶部抬高了10像素。
无论你使用哪一种方法,向上偏移都可以实现元素的不同位置和布局。然而,在使用这些属性时,需要注意它们可能对其他元素产生的影响,因为它们往往会改变元素的盒子模型,进而影响其他元素的位置。